Are you interested in astrophysics and how advanced computational methods can investigate the dynamics of objects ranging from neutron stars to exoplanets? Would you like to be part of a supportive group at the University of Leeds? • Collaborate with Professor Hollerbach and Dr. Andrei Igoshev at Newcastle University on numerical modelling of magnetic fields in neutron star interiors. • Work with Professors Barker and Hollerbach on modelling tidal flows in stars and exoplanets. These roles involve applying modern numerical techniques to explore the evolution of magnetic fields and fluid flows, using existing codes and developing new ones, with potential comparisons to astronomical data. You should have a PhD in Mathematics, Astrophysics, or a related field, with a strong background in numerical methods and expertise relevant to the specific research option. Candidates should demonstrate the ability to conduct independent research and have a developing publication record in international journals.
